What Factors Should You Consider When Choosing an AGN Battery for Your RV?
When choosing the best AGM battery for your RV, several important factors should be considered to ensure optimal performance and longevity.
- Capacity (Ah): The capacity of the AGM battery, measured in amp-hours (Ah), determines how much energy it can store and provide. A higher capacity means the battery can power your RV appliances and systems for a longer duration without needing a recharge.
- Size and Weight: The physical dimensions and weight of the battery are crucial for fitting it into your RV’s battery compartment. Ensure the chosen battery can be accommodated without exceeding weight limits, as excess weight can affect your RV’s handling and fuel efficiency.
- Cold Cranking Amps (CCA): CCA measures the battery’s ability to start an engine in cold temperatures. For RVs, especially those used in colder climates, a battery with a higher CCA rating is advantageous to ensure reliable starts and operation.
- Cycle Life: This refers to the number of charge and discharge cycles a battery can undergo before its capacity significantly diminishes. AGM batteries with a longer cycle life are more cost-effective over time, as they require less frequent replacement.
- Self-Discharge Rate: AGM batteries have a low self-discharge rate, meaning they can retain their charge for longer periods when not in use. A lower self-discharge rate is beneficial for RV owners who may not use their vehicles regularly.
- Warranty: A good warranty is indicative of the manufacturer’s confidence in their product’s quality. Look for AGM batteries that offer a robust warranty period, as this can save you money on replacements and repairs in the long run.
- Brand Reputation: Consider the reputation of the battery manufacturer. Established brands with positive customer reviews often provide more reliable products and better customer service. Researching user experiences can help you make a more informed decision.

Which AGN Battery Options Are Best Suited for RV Use?
The best AGN battery options for RV use combine efficiency, longevity, and reliability for power needs on the road.
- AGM Batteries: Absorbent Glass Mat (AGM) batteries are sealed, maintenance-free, and offer excellent deep cycle capabilities.
- Lithium Iron Phosphate (LiFePO4) Batteries: These batteries provide a high energy density, lightweight structure, and a long lifespan, making them ideal for RVs.
- Gel Batteries: Gel batteries are similar to AGM but use a gel electrolyte, which makes them less prone to spillage and safer for use in RVs.
- Flooded Lead Acid Batteries: While they are the most economical option, they require regular maintenance and ventilation, which can be a drawback for RV users.
AGM Batteries: AGM batteries are designed to withstand deep cycling, making them suitable for RV applications where power usage can vary significantly. Their sealed design prevents spills and enables safe installation in various orientations, while their low self-discharge rate ensures they hold charge well during periods of inactivity.
Lithium Iron Phosphate (LiFePO4) Batteries: These batteries are becoming increasingly popular for RVs due to their lightweight nature and high discharge rates. They can be charged quickly and have a lifespan that can exceed 10 years, significantly reducing the need for replacements compared to traditional batteries.
Gel Batteries: Gel batteries offer a safer alternative to flooded batteries, as the gel electrolyte minimizes the risk of leaks. They are also resistant to vibration and shock, which is beneficial in the mobile environment of an RV and can perform well in various temperatures.
Flooded Lead Acid Batteries: While these batteries are generally more affordable upfront, they require regular maintenance, including checking water levels and ensuring proper ventilation. Their performance can also be affected by temperature extremes, making them less suitable for full-time RV living where reliability is key.
